Jamie Jessop, a senior at Davis is a member of the D’Ettes. Jamie has been dancing ever since she was four years old, starting at academy one, moving to l to dance, and now a dancer for Davis. She says she dances for fun, making new friends, and supporting the school. She wouldn’t pursue this as a career, she just does it for fun.

Her routine on the team is rigorous. She has practice every a day and before her performances at games early in the morning at 6 in the morning until school starts. She has to come to practice all ready with her make up done, which she does herself, and her hair done. Talk about commitment! She has danced for Davis all three years shes attended here. But regardless of the commitment, she still loves dancing with her friends and getting physical activity.
